Why These Are the Top Mazda Repair Auto Repair Shops in Enumclaw

** The Mazda repair market in Enumclaw is characterized by a handful of high-quality, independent auto repair shops rather than dedicated Mazda-specific specialists. The competition is moderate but of a generally high caliber, with these top providers distinguishing themselves through long-term community presence, excellent customer satisfaction ratings, and demonstrated technical competency. For highly specialized services like **rotary engine (RX-series) rebuilds**, owners would likely need to travel to a metropolitan center like Tacoma or Seattle. Similarly, while the listed shops can perform diagnostics and standard service on turbocharged Skyactiv-G engines (e.g., Mazda CX-5/CX-9 Turbo, Mazda3 Turbo), extensive performance tuning would fall outside the typical scope of these generalists. Pricing in Enumclaw is generally competitive and often more affordable than dealership labor rates in larger nearby cities, with typical shop rates ranging from **$120 - $150 per hour**. What are the most common Mazda repair issues for drivers in the Enumclaw area?

In Enumclaw, Mazda owners frequently encounter issues related to our climate and terrain, such as premature brake wear from frequent stops on hilly roads and corrosion on undercarriage components due to wet, rainy conditions. Specific models, like the CX-5, may also need attention for infotainment system glitches or minor electrical gremlins, which local specialists are well-versed in diagnosing.

Are Mazda repair costs in Enumclaw generally higher than for other brands?

Mazda repair costs in Enumclaw are typically on par with other mainstream Japanese brands like Honda or Toyota, and are often more affordable than European makes. However, costs can vary between independent shops and dealerships; for complex issues, a local independent specialist with the right tools often provides significant savings over the nearest Mazda dealer, which is located in Puyallup or Federal Way.

When should I seek local service for a Mazda-specific warning light, like the check engine or tire pressure light?

Seek service immediately for flashing warning lights, which indicate severe issues. For a solid check engine light, a local Enumclaw shop can quickly perform a diagnostic scan to identify the issue, which is often related to emissions sensors affected by our driving cycles. Tire pressure lights are common with temperature drops in the foothills and can often be reset after checking pressures.

What local driving conditions in Enumclaw should influence my Mazda's maintenance schedule?

The stop-and-go traffic on SR 410, combined with steep grades and gravel from nearby rural roads, necessitates more frequent brake inspections, tire rotations, and windshield wiper replacements. Furthermore, preparing your Mazda's battery and cooling system for both summer heat and winter cold snaps in the foothills is essential for reliable year-round performance.
